PSL BUILD INFORMATION HOT OFF THE PRESS!
There has been some concern and confusion
over the overall length of the PSL receiver blank.

Our PSL blank was copied from an original PSL receiver and all dimensions regarding the length and the relationship of the stiffening plates for this receiver body are original. There is NO mistake in length of the receiver blank body.

The following information is provided to assist our customers with building an original PSL configuration blank. It is for clarification.
This view shows that a little less than half of the rear trunnion is not in the receiver body. The top rivet for the rear trunnion goes through the stiffening plates and the trunnion but NOT through the receiver AT ALL. The stiffening plates have .064 of material removed so that the plates fit flush to the rear stock.
This view shows where the stiffening plate and the receiver body butt together at the thick portion of the stiffening plate.
These views show the relationship of the stiffening plates to the receiver body. The stiffening plates are meant to be welded into place and the rivets are for anchoring the rear trunnion into place. It is unclear why the original manufacturers/designers of this rifle decided to use the stiffening plates in leiu of designing a longer receiver body but this IS the original design and it is what we provide.
